Buy: Taraxacum officinale

Parts Used:

Leaves and Roots

Traditional Use:

As a remedy for loss of appetite

Common Dose:

1 tsp. tincture 3x daily

Activity:

Slightly diuretic

... "Dandelion root is a registered drug in Canada, sold principally as a diuretic. A leaf decoction can be drunk to "purify the blood", for the treatment of anemia, jaundice, and also for nervousness. A hepatoprotective effect of chemicals extracted from dandelion root has been reported. Drunk before meals, dandelion root coffee is claimed to stimulate digestive functions and function as a liver tonic".
